Transaction 753e43a8de1fa89146fe70d02deadefcd619b06e17077087e8cba7f2109dd358
1 Input
2 Outputs
- 753e43a8de1fa89146fe70d02deadefcd619b06e17077087e8cba7f2109dd358:0
- 753e43a8de1fa89146fe70d02deadefcd619b06e17077087e8cba7f2109dd358:1
value 2194544
address 3M7PnCykCQzA4G8taXPFJFkDa6vxY5jdna
value 3365385
address 1Bz5w7UpMG8MkaL4QhsUXnGzPjnhe1X8S8